Sleepiness and Vitamin D Levels in Patients with Obstructive Sleep Apnea
Kostas Archontogeorgis1, Nicholas-Tiberio Economou1, Panagiotis Bargiotas2
1Department of Pneumonology, Medical School, Democritus University of Thrace, 68100 Alexandroupolis, Greece.
Low Vitamin D levels are linked to excessive daytime sleepiness (EDS) in obstructive sleep apnea (OSA) patients. Sleep hypoxia may contribute to this association, highlighting the importance of Vitamin D status in OSA management.
Area of Science:
- Endocrinology and Sleep Medicine
- Nutritional Science and Sleep Disorders
Background:
- Obstructive sleep apnea (OSA) is a prevalent sleep disorder characterized by repeated episodes of upper airway obstruction during sleep.
- Excessive daytime sleepiness (EDS) is a common and often debilitating symptom in patients with OSA.
- Vitamin D deficiency has been implicated in various health conditions, and its role in sleep disorders is an emerging area of research.
Purpose of the Study:
- To investigate the association between serum 25-hydroxyvitamin D [25(OH)D] levels and excessive daytime sleepiness (EDS) in patients diagnosed with obstructive sleep apnea (OSA).
- To explore the relationship between Vitamin D status, sleep parameters, and the severity of sleepiness in an OSA cohort.
Main Methods:
- Cross-sectional study involving newly diagnosed OSA patients, stratified by the presence or absence of EDS (Epworth Sleepiness Scale [ESS] > 10 vs. < 10).
- All participants underwent overnight polysomnography to assess sleep-related parameters.
- Serum 25(OH)D levels were quantified using radioimmunoassay.
Main Results:
- Patients with EDS exhibited significantly higher apnea-hypopnea index (AHI) values and lower mean serum 25(OH)D levels compared to non-somnolent patients.
- In patients with EDS, serum 25(OH)D levels showed a negative correlation with ESS scores, AHI, and arousal index, and a positive correlation with average oxyhemoglobin saturation.
- Serum Vitamin D levels were identified as an independent predictor of EDS in OSA patients, with lower levels associated with increased sleepiness.
Conclusions:
- Excessive daytime sleepiness in patients with obstructive sleep apnea is associated with lower serum Vitamin D levels.
- Sleep hypoxia, indicated by reduced oxyhemoglobin saturation, may play a significant role in the relationship between Vitamin D status and EDS in OSA.
